Liverpool‘s star center-back Virgil van Dijk has remained tight-lipped about his contract situation, telling Sky Sports, “Nothing,” when asked for updates on a potential new deal. However, the club is reportedly in advanced talks to extend his contract by two years, securing the services of one of the world’s best defenders until 2027.

Since joining Liverpool in 2018, Van Dijk has established himself as one of the premier center-backs in world soccer. His leadership, defensive prowess, aerial ability, and reading of the game have been instrumental in Liverpool’s success, including their Premier League and Champions League triumphs. Despite his 33 years, Van Dijk continues to perform at an elite level, remaining a crucial figure in both the defensive and attacking phases of play.

Aware of Van Dijk’s importance, Liverpool is determined to retain him for as long as possible. Sources close to the club indicate that a two-year contract extension is on the table, keeping him at Anfield until 2027. This move would not only provide defensive stability but would also ensure the team benefits from Van Dijk’s leadership and experience, both on and off the pitch. The longevity of Van Dijk’s career makes this an important moment for the team.

While some might question the length of the extension given Van Dijk’s age, his consistency and professionalism demonstrate his ability to compete at the highest level. Manager Arne Slot clearly retains complete confidence in the Dutch international, and Van Dijk’s influence in the dressing room is undeniable.
